Diversity & Demographics FAQs for US ZIP Code 23111

The largest racial or ethnic group in US ZIP Code 23111 is White (Non-Hispanic), which makes up 83.9% of the total population.

Since 2021, the diversity index for US ZIP Code 23111 has decreased. The area currently has a diversity score of 28.8/100, which is considered a Moderate-Low level of diversity.
